Integral Horsepower Motors Market Outlook

The global integral horsepower motors market is projected to reach approximately USD 35 billion by 2035, growing at a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 6%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. The push towards energy efficiency and environmental sustainability in industrial operations is one of the primary growth factors for this market. As governments and organizations worldwide increasingly focus on reducing carbon footprints, there is a strong demand for high-efficiency motors that not only improve operational effectiveness but also contribute to energy conservation. Additionally, the rising adoption of automation across various industries is creating substantial opportunities for integral horsepower motors, which are critical for powering a range of machinery and equipment. Furthermore, advancements in motor technologies, such as the development of smart motors integrated with IoT solutions, are enhancing their appeal to manufacturers seeking to optimize performance and reduce maintenance costs.

By Type

AC Motors:

AC motors are among the most widely used integral horsepower motors, primarily due to their robustness, efficiency, and versatility. They are employed in a variety of applications, ranging from industrial machinery to HVAC systems. The continuous advancement in AC motor design has led to enhanced performance characteristics, making them suitable for high-torque applications. Furthermore, the integration of variable frequency drives (VFDs) with AC motors has significantly improved their efficiency and operational flexibility, allowing for better speed control and energy savings. This adaptability is a key driver of growth in the AC motors segment, as industries increasingly seek to optimize their operations for improved productivity and reduced energy consumption.

DC Motors:

DC motors are recognized for their high starting torque and ease of speed control, making them a preferred choice in applications requiring precise motion control. The flexibility of DC motors allows them to be employed in various sectors, including automotive and consumer electronics. The recent technological advancements in brushless DC motors are further enhancing their appeal, as they offer improved efficiency and lifespan compared to traditional brushed counterparts. As industries continue to evolve, the demand for DC motors is expected to grow, particularly in applications where high performance and reliability are paramount.

Hermetic Motors:

Hermetic motors are specially designed to operate in demanding environments, often where exposure to moisture and contaminants would damage traditional motors. These motors are encapsulated to protect internal components, making them ideal for refrigeration and air conditioning applications. The increasing focus on energy efficiency and reliability in HVAC systems is driving the adoption of hermetic motors. Their ability to provide consistent performance under varying conditions is a significant advantage, leading to a steady growth trajectory in this segment of the market as industries prioritize dependable motor solutions in their operations.

Fractional HP Motors:

Fractional horsepower (HP) motors are smaller motors that deliver power in fractions of one horsepower, making them ideal for applications such as small appliances, fans, and tools. These motors are highly efficient and cost-effective, contributing to their widespread use across various consumer and industrial products. The growing consumer electronics market and the demand for compact, energy-efficient appliances are propelling the growth of fractional HP motors. As manufacturers look to enhance product performance while reducing energy consumption, the fractional HP motors segment is expected to expand in the coming years.

Other Motors:

This category encompasses various specialized motors that cater to niche applications not covered by the primary types. These may include stepper motors, servo motors, and linear motors, which are essential for precision applications in robotics, CNC machines, and medical equipment. The increasing trend toward automation and advanced manufacturing processes is driving demand for these specialized motors. As industries seek to enhance operational efficiency and precision, the role of these other motors is becoming increasingly significant, ensuring steady growth within this segment of the integral horsepower motors market.

By Voltage

Low Voltage:

Low voltage motors are widely used in applications where high power is not a primary requirement, typically operating at voltages below 1,000 volts. These motors are commonly found in commercial and residential settings, including he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) systems, pumps, and fans. The growing emphasis on energy efficiency and the increasing demand for electric vehicles (EVs) are boosting the low voltage segment significantly. As industries aim to minimize operating costs and reduce energy consumption, low voltage motors are expected to play a crucial role, fostering growth in this segment of the market.

Medium Voltage:

Medium voltage motors operate within the voltage range of 1,000 to 10,000 volts, making them suitable for more demanding applications in industries such as mining, oil and gas, and chemical processing. The need for reliable and efficient power transmission in these sectors is propelling the growth of medium voltage motors. As industries increasingly adopt automation and advanced control techniques, medium voltage motors are becoming essential for enhancing operational efficiency. Additionally, the growing focus on renewable energy sources and the electrification of industrial processes are contributing to the increasing adoption of medium voltage motors in various applications.

High Voltage:

High voltage motors, which operate at voltages exceeding 10,000 volts, are crucial for large-scale industrial applications that require substantial power output. These motors are typically used in industries such as power generation, water treatment, and heavy manufacturing. The rising demand for energy-efficient solutions and the increasing focus on sustainable practices are driving the growth of the high voltage segment. As industries invest in upgrading their equipment to comply with regulatory standards and to improve performance, the demand for high voltage motors is expected to increase significantly, contributing to the overall growth of the integral horsepower motors market.

By Efficiency Class

Standard Efficiency Motors:

Standard efficiency motors are designed to meet basic performance requirements while providing adequate energy consumption. These motors are commonly used in applications where cost is a primary concern and energy savings are not the top priority. While they have been the workhorse of many industries for years, the increasing focus on sustainability and energy efficiency is leading many manufacturers to transition to higher-efficiency solutions. Nevertheless, standard efficiency motors will continue to hold a portion of the market, particularly in applications where operational costs are minimized and initial investments are critical.

Energy Efficient Motors:

Energy efficient motors are designed to provide improved performance while reducing energy consumption compared to standard efficiency models. These motors are increasingly being adopted across various industries as organizations seek to decrease operational costs and comply with stricter energy regulations. The growing awareness of energy conservation and environmental impact is propelling the demand for energy-efficient motors. Additionally, the integration of advanced technologies, such as variable speed drives, enhances the performance and efficiency of these motors, making them a popular choice among manufacturers looking to optimize their operations.

Premium Efficiency Motors:

Premium efficiency motors are engineered to provide superior energy savings and performance compared to standard and energy-efficient motors. These motors are gaining traction in industries where operational efficiency and energy savings are critical to maintaining profitability. The increasing implementation of energy efficiency standards and regulations is driving the adoption of premium efficiency motors. Furthermore, the long-term cost savings associated with reduced energy consumption and maintenance make these motors an attractive investment for manufacturers seeking to enhance their competitive edge in the market.

Super Premium Efficiency Motors:

Super premium efficiency motors represent the highest tier of motor efficiency, designed to minimize energy consumption and maximize performance. These motors are essential for industries focused on sustainability and significant energy savings. As global energy prices continue to rise and regulations become more stringent, the demand for super premium efficiency motors is expected to increase. Industries that require high reliability and low operational costs are increasingly adopting these motors, further driving growth in this segment. The initial investment may be higher, but the long-term cost savings and environmental benefits make them an attractive choice for manufacturers.

Threats

Despite the promising growth prospects of the integral horsepower motors market, several threats could hinder market expansion. One major concern is the fluctuating prices of raw materials used in motor production, such as steel and copper. These fluctuations can significantly impact manufacturing costs, leading to potential price increases for end-users. If manufacturers are unable to absorb these costs, it may result in higher prices for consumers, potentially stalling demand. Additionally, the ongoing global supply chain disruptions, exacerbated by geopolitical tensions and the aftermath of the COVID-19 pandemic, could hinder the availability of critical components for motor production, complicating the ability to meet market demand effectively.

Another threat to consider is the increasing competition from alternative motor technologies, such as direct drive systems and piezoelectric motors. These technologies may offer advantages in specific applications that could draw industry focus away from traditional integral horsepower motors. As industries adopt new technologies for improved performance and efficiency, traditional motor manufacturers may face challenges in maintaining their market share. To combat this, companies must invest in research and development to innovate and adapt to changing market dynamics, ensuring they can compete effectively against emerging technologies.
